WebAug 25, 2024 · You just need to explain why you think the band is wrong and provide some evidence. You can call the VOA on 03000 501 501 in England or 03000 505 505 in Wales. You’ll normally receive a decision from the VOA within two months. It might change your Council Tax band which will mean your bill will be revised or tell you why your band hasn’t ... WebAug 5, 2024 · The government's Valuation Office Agency (VOA) says that of the 40,620 cases put forward in 2024-21, 11,670 successfully had their property moved to a lower council tax band. However, 40 households saw their bills increase - an off-putting prospect, but one that only affected 0.1% of all appeals. WebApr 1, 2024 · Many homes have been in the wrong council tax bands since 1991. In 1991, the Government needed to bring every property in the country into a valuation band to launch its new council tax scheme. However, since time was limited and the job was big, the people in charge enlisted estate agents and outsourced assistance..
